Susan Swift is the Business Development Manager at the Grief Centre of WA. In 2021, Susan was the recipient of the Australian Institute of Company Directors Governance Foundations for NFP Directors Scholarship.

Governance Foundations for NFP Directors - AICD (2021)

I enjoyed the depth, breadth and quality of the information together with the opportunity to meet and network with other people with similar mind sets and issues/challenges. The course has allowed me to gain more knowledge with advanced tools and frameworks to be used for the organisation’s strategy, governance, risk and financial management. It has enabled me to be more confident in how to question and explore issues without swaying into operational matters. In particular better clarity on how the board charter, code of conduct and what sort of information a board should be requesting from the management has without a doubt provided a better sense of how the board “stewards” the organisation. Personally it has given me greater confidence particularly in the area of the “rights of directors” and the clearer understanding of the roles and responsibilities of a NFP Director.
